What is an Induction Hob?
An induction hob is a sophisticated cooking surface area that uses electromagnetic energy to heat pots and pans directly, instead of the cooking surface itself. Unlike conventional gas or electric cooktops, induction hobs offer rapid heat-up times and precise temperature control.
How Does Induction Cooking Work?
Induction cooking works using a basic concept of magnetism. When compatible cookware is put on the induction surface area, an electro-magnetic coil beneath the glass surface produces an electromagnetic field. This electromagnetic field induces heat in the ferrous (magnetic) material of the pot or pan, allowing it to heat rapidly while the cooktop stays cool to the touch.
Benefits of Induction Cooking
- Speed and Efficiency:.Induction hobs are incredibly faster than gas and electric options. They can boil water in a portion of the time.
- Precision:.The capability to manage temperature level with amazing accuracy reduces cooking errors and enhances meal quality.
- Security:.The surface remains cool, lowering the danger of burns. Numerous models include auto shut-off features, which boost safety in the kitchen.
- Energy Efficient:.Induction cooking is more energy-efficient, as it directly heats the pots and pans without losing heat to the surrounding environment.
- Easy to Clean:.The smooth, flat surface of induction hobs makes cleaning up a breeze, as spills do not bake onto the hot surface.
- Smooth Design:.Modern induction hobs include aesthetic interest cooking areas while using up less counter space compared to standard cooktops.
